Authors are invited to submit papers addressing, but not limited to, the following areas:

  • Edge computing architectures and frameworks
  • Fog computing applications in smart cities
  • Data processing at the edge of networks
  • Security challenges in edge computing
  • Latency reduction techniques in edge computing
  • Resource management in fog environments
  • Edge computing for IoT applications
  • Real-time analytics in edge computing
  • Interoperability between edge and cloud
  • Edge computing for autonomous vehicles
  • Scalability issues in edge computing
  • Edge computing and machine learning integration
  • Energy efficiency in fog computing
  • Use cases for edge computing in healthcare
  • Edge device security and privacy concerns
  • Data synchronization between edge and cloud
  • Edge computing in industrial automation
  • Challenges of deploying edge applications
  • Edge computing for augmented reality
  • Future trends in edge and fog computing
